Web16 dic 2024 · The German Alphabet Has One More Consonant Than English. German and English use the same script (Roman), but Germans, in an effort to be more precise, have an extra consonant, the sharp s or ß. In English, this is written as ss, but this can sometimes result in confusion. For example, Masse means ‘mass’, but Maße means ‘dimensions’. WebHAVING FUN - Translation in German - bab.la. But you now know that you can … how can you reduce your taxesWebSo to say that something is fun you have to use the verb “machen” instead. In other word words, the German understanding is that something does (in the sense of “causes”, “brings about”) fun to person. Or to put it in German, etwas macht jemandem (dative case!) Spaß. e.g. Tennis macht (mir) Spaß (Tennis is fun for me) Mir macht ... how can you reduce your triglyceride levels
